LAKE GENEVA, Wis. (CBS 58) -- Lake Geneva Police were called out to a crash involving a dump truck on Thursday.
It happened around 8:39 a.m. on the off-ramp to Highway 50 westbound and Highway 120 southbound at Highway 12.
Upon arrival, officers located one dump truck involved in the crash that had sustained severe damage.
The operator of the dump truck was pronounced dead at the scene.
The cause of the crash is under investigation.
The victim's identity is being withheld pending family notification.
